Missoula, Mt vs Phrae Climate & Distance Between

Thailand flag
  • The distance between Missoula, Mt, Usa and Phrae, Thailand is approximately 12,011 km or 7,464 mi.
  • To reach Missoula, Mt in this distance one would set out from Phrae bearing 23.8°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Missoula, Mt bearing 145.8° or SE .
  • Missoula, Mt has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Phrae has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Missoula, Mt is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Phrae is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 19.8 °C (35.6°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 16.3 °C (29.3°F) more in Missoula, Mt.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 753.1 mm (29.6 in) less which is equivalent to 753.1 l/m² (18.48 US gal/ft²) or 7,531,000 l/ha (805,114 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 27.1° lower in Missoula, Mt than in Phrae.
